What affects the price

When you are budgeting for drywall, the final number depends on a few specific factors. The size of the room is the biggest driver, but the complexity of the installation matters just as much. For example, high ceilings, intricate corners, or tight spaces require more labor time. If you need special moisture-resistant boards for a bathroom or fire-rated panels for a garage, material costs will shift accordingly. About this service

Drywall comes in various thicknesses, typically ranging from 1/4 inch for repairs to 5/8 inch for fire-rated applications. Choosing the right thickness is vital for the structural integrity and sound dampening of your walls. You need to consider thickness when planning a renovation to ensure it aligns with your existing framing and building codes. What is drywall corner bead, and when is it used?

Drywall corner bead is a protective strip, usually metal or vinyl, installed at exterior corners. It reinforces the corner, preventing damage from impacts and creating a straight, clean edge. It's applied before joint compound, which is then feathered over the bead. Proper installation is crucial for durability and a professional appearance.

What's the best spackle for filling holes in drywall?

For small holes and minor repairs, lightweight spackle is a popular choice as it's easy to sand. For larger holes or areas that require more durability, a vinyl-based spackling compound offers better adhesion and strength. Professionals often select their spackle based on the size and type of repair needed for a lasting fix.

What are the different types of drywall panels available?

Drywall panels come in various types, including standard gypsum board, moisture-resistant (green board), fire-resistant (Type X), and sound-dampening panels. Each type is engineered for specific environments or performance requirements, such as high-humidity areas or rooms needing enhanced fire safety.
